In the near future, the Beehive flag will become the “civic flag” and be used more day to day, while the Ceremonial flag will be more “sophisticated” and used for official governmental purposes. Both flags will represent us and they’ll do it together.

This year, Utah's budget will be the biggest in state history at an estimated $28.4 billion for fiscal year 2024. A major focus of the budget will be cutting taxes for Utahns. The Legislature will continue to prioritize cutting taxes and giving Utahns back their hard-earned money
